thumb|200 px|Varteig municipal coat of arms from 1979 showed Inga of Varteig, mother of King Håkon Håkonson Varteig is a village in Sarpsborg and a former municipality in Østfold County, Norway.
==Summary== thumb|left|300 px|Varteig Church Varteig is located north of the city of Sarpsborg and east of the Glomma river. Varteig was part of the Tune municipality until 1861. It was designated to be a municipality by a split from Tune in 1861. At that time Varteig had a population of 1,405. On 1 January 1992 a small part of the district Furuholmen, with 12 inhabitants, was moved to Rakkestad municipality. The rest of Varteig was incorporated into Sarpsborg along with Tune and Skjeberg.
